## FAQ: Sensor Drift (Fernhollow Controller)

Q: Humidity readings are drifting overnight — what should on-call do?

A: Drift beyond two points usually means the calibration store went stale. Trigger a recalibration cycle from the Fernhollow console; most drift clears within an hour. If the calibration store is locked after a failed cycle, it must be unlocked manually using the recovery passphrase below.

unlock words, yawig-kagef: gordor-holvan-ulaael-pramir-ulaiel-tamdor

## Signing — Stallwatch occupancy feed

All builds of the Stallwatch collector are signed before deploy to the Penrose garage gateways. Reviewers: confirm the CI signing step ran and the manifest hash matches the tagged commit. Unsigned builds are rejected at the gateway, no exceptions. For local verification during review, check signatures against the current deploy key below.

rollout seal: bky4_DFM9

## Build Provenance — Chalkline Timetable Solver

Support folks: every Chalkline release carries a provenance stamp so you can tell exactly which commit and solver ruleset a school is running. When a customer reports weird scheduling output, grab the stamp from their About screen first — it saves everyone a round trip. For reference, the current production build's token is shown below.

pipeline stamp: htk3_69f

## v2.8 — Changed defaults (ScanBridge)

ScanBridge now defaults to continuous-scan mode off. Beep feedback is enabled; duplicate-scan suppression window raised from 2s to 5s. Older Pellet-series handhelds ignore the suppression window — known limitation. Tickets about double scans should reference this entry. New installs pick up the following defaults automatically.

settings of tagef-bawif:
DRUIX_HOST=druix.zemvarlabs.internal
DRUIX_PORT=8000

To the release manager: I'm passing ownership of the Pellwick deep-link router to Sorrel before the 4.2 cut. The intent-matching table now lives in the Farrowgate config service; stale entries were purged last sprint. Watch the fallback route — it silently swallows malformed slugs, which inflated our drop-off metrics in March. The staging resolver needs its keystore unlocked before each regression pass, and that keystore accepts only one credential. For the signing vault, the recovery phrase is noted directly below.

recovery phrase for tafog-fafog: novix-novdor-fraath-brieth-olieth-oliix-rusix-wenion-julax-druox